Large language models present privacy risks
Briefly

The use of large language models is creating data privacy issues because they have tendencies to disclose personal information they scrape from the internet without the consent of the data subject, Axios reports.
Artificial intelligence data leaks come in many forms, such as an accidental disclosure or through malicious actions like building a model that circumvents privacy controls.
